Here are some examples:
* "The stop sign was red." (The sign itself is the noun.)
* "He gave me a sign that he was happy." (The sign is an action or gesture, functioning as a noun.)
* "There were signs of life on the planet." (Signs are evidence or indications, functioning as nouns.)
However, "sign" can also be a verb:
* "He signed his name on the document." (He performed the action of signing.)
So, the part of speech "sign" depends on how it's used in a sentence.
